Blonde Venus (1932)

Poster for Blonde Venus

What could she do but flee from love? She loved two men at once!

In an effort to be able to afford expensive treatment for her gravely ill American husband, a retired German entertainer returns to the cabaret as Blonde Venus and catches the eye of a wealthy politician.
